// Package spectator provides a minimal Go implementation of the Netflix Java
// Spectator library. The goal of this package is to allow Go programs to emit
// metrics to Atlas.
//
// Please refer to the Java Spectator documentation for information on
// spectator / Atlas fundamentals: https://netflix.github.io/spectator/en/latest/
package spectator
import (
"context"
"fmt"
"io/ioutil"
"math"
"path/filepath"
"sort"
"strings"
"sync"
"time"
jsoniter "github.com/json-iterator/go"
"golang.org/x/sync/semaphore"
)
var json = jsoniter.ConfigCompatibleWithStandardLibrary
// Meter represents the functionality presented by the individual meter types.
type Meter interface {
MeterId() *Id
Measure() []Measurement
}
// Config represents the Registry's configuration.
type Config struct {
Frequency time.Duration `json:"frequency"`
Timeout time.Duration `json:"timeout"`
Uri string `json:"uri"`
BatchSize int `json:"batch_size"`
CommonTags map[string]string `json:"common_tags"`
PublishWorkers int64 `json:"publish_workers"`
Log Logger
IsEnabled func() bool
IpcTimerRecord func(registry *Registry, id *Id, duration time.Duration)
}
// Registry is the collection of meters being reported.
type Registry struct {
clock Clock
config *Config
meters map[string]Meter
started bool
mutex *sync.Mutex
http *HttpClient
sentMetrics *Counter
invalidMetrics *Counter
droppedHttp *Counter
droppedOther *Counter
quit chan struct{}
publishSync *semaphore.Weighted
}
// NewRegistryConfiguredBy loads a new Config JSON file from disk at the path
// specified.
//
// Please note, when this method is used to load the configuration both
// Config.Frequency and Config.Timeout are assumed to not be a time.Duration but
// an int64 with second precision. As such this function multiplies those
// configuration values by time.Second, to convert them to time.Duration values.
func NewRegistryConfiguredBy(filePath string) (*Registry, error) {
path := filepath.Clean(filePath)
/* #nosec G304 */
bytes, err := ioutil.ReadFile(path)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
var config Config
err = json.Unmarshal(bytes, &config)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
config.Timeout *= time.Second
config.Frequency *= time.Second
return NewRegistry(&config), nil
}
// NewRegistry generates a new registry from the config.
//
// If the config.IpcTimerRecord is unset, a default implementation is used.
//
// If config.IsEnabled is unset, it defaults to an implementation that returns
// true.
//
// If config.Log is unset, it defaults to using the default logger.
func NewRegistry(config *Config) *Registry {
if config.IpcTimerRecord == nil {
config.IpcTimerRecord = func(registry *Registry, id *Id, duration time.Duration) {
registry.TimerWithId(id).Record(duration)
}
}
if config.IsEnabled == nil {
config.IsEnabled = func() bool { return true }
}
if config.Log == nil {
config.Log = defaultLogger()
}
if config.PublishWorkers < 1 {
config.PublishWorkers = 1
}
r := &Registry{
&SystemClock{}, config,
map[string]Meter{},
false,
&sync.Mutex{}, nil, nil, nil, nil, nil,
make(chan struct{}),
semaphore.NewWeighted(config.PublishWorkers),
}
r.http = NewHttpClient(r, r.config.Timeout)
r.sentMetrics = r.Counter("spectator.measurements",
map[string]string{"id": "sent"})
r.invalidMetrics = r.Counter("spectator.measurements",
map[string]string{"id": "dropped", "error": "validation"})
r.droppedHttp = r.Counter("spectator.measurements",
map[string]string{"id": "dropped", "error": "http-error"})
r.droppedOther = r.Counter("spectator.measurements",
map[string]string{"id": "dropped", "error": "other"})
return r
}
// NewRegistryWithClock returns a new registry with the clock overriden to the
// one injected here. This function is mostly used for testing.
func NewRegistryWithClock(config *Config, clock Clock) *Registry {
r := NewRegistry(config)
r.clock = clock
return r
}
// GetLogger returns the internal logger.
func (r *Registry) GetLogger() Logger {
return r.config.Log
}
// Meters returns all the internal meters.
func (r *Registry) Meters() []Meter {
r.mutex.Lock()
defer r.mutex.Unlock()
meters := make([]Meter, 0, len(r.meters))
for _, m := range r.meters {
meters = append(meters, m)
}
return meters
}
// Clock returns the internal clock.
func (r *Registry) Clock() Clock {
return r.clock
}
// SetLogger overrides the internal logger.
func (r *Registry) SetLogger(logger Logger) {
r.config.Log = logger
}
// Start spins-up the background goroutine(s) for emitting collected metrics.
func (r *Registry) Start() error {
if r.config == nil || r.config.Uri == "" {
err := "registry config has no uri. Ignoring Start request"
r.config.Log.Infof(err)
return fmt.Errorf(err)
}
if r.started {
err := "registry has already started. Ignoring Start request"
r.config.Log.Infof(err)
return fmt.Errorf(err)
}
r.started = true
r.quit = make(chan struct{})
ticker := time.NewTicker(r.config.Frequency)
go func() {
for {
select {
case <-ticker.C:
// send measurements
r.config.Log.Debugf("Sending measurements")
r.publish()
case <-r.quit:
ticker.Stop()
r.config.Log.Infof("Send last updates and quit")
return
}
}
}()
return nil
}
// Stop shuts down the running goroutine(s), and attempts to flush the metrics.
func (r *Registry) Stop() {
close(r.quit)
r.started = false
// flush metrics
r.publish()
}
func shouldSendMeasurement(measurement Measurement) bool {
v := measurement.value
if math.IsNaN(v) {
return false
}
isGauge := opFromTags(measurement.id.tags) == maxOp
return isGauge || v >= 0
}
// Measurements returns the list of internal measurements that should be sent.
func (r *Registry) Measurements() []Measurement {
var measurements []Measurement
r.mutex.Lock()
defer r.mutex.Unlock()
for _, meter := range r.meters {
for _, measure := range meter.Measure() {
if shouldSendMeasurement(measure) {
measurements = append(measurements, measure)
}
}
}
return measurements
}
type atlasMessage struct {
Type string `json:"type"`
ErrorCount int `json:"errorCount"`
Message []string `json:"message"`
}
func getUnique(messages []string) string {
uniq := map[string]struct{}{}
for _, msg := range messages {
uniq[msg] = struct{}{}
}
keys := make([]string, 0, len(uniq))
for key := range uniq {
keys = append(keys, key)
}
return strings.Join(keys, "; ")
}
func (r *Registry) sendBatch(measurements []Measurement) {
numMeasurements := int64(len(measurements))
r.config.Log.Debugf("Sending %d measurements to %s", len(measurements), r.config.Uri)
jsonBytes, err := r.measurementsToJson(measurements)
if err != nil {
r.droppedOther.Add(numMeasurements)
r.config.Log.Errorf("Unable to convert measurements to json: %v", err)
} else {
var resp HttpResponse
resp, err = r.http.PostJson(r.config.Uri, jsonBytes)
if err != nil {
r.droppedHttp.Add(numMeasurements)
} else {
sent := int64(0)
dropped := int64(0)
if resp.status == 200 {
sent = numMeasurements
} else if resp.status < 500 {
var atlasResponse atlasMessage
err = json.Unmarshal(resp.body, &atlasResponse)
if err != nil {
r.config.Log.Errorf("%d measurement(s) dropped. Http status: %d", numMeasurements, resp.status)
r.droppedOther.Add(numMeasurements)
} else {
dropped = int64(atlasResponse.ErrorCount)
sent = numMeasurements - dropped
// get the unique error messages
var errorMsg string
if len(atlasResponse.Message) > 0 {
errorMsg = getUnique(atlasResponse.Message)
} else {
errorMsg = "unknown cause"
}
r.config.Log.Infof("%d measurement(s) dropped due to validation errors: %s",
dropped, errorMsg)
}
} else {
// 5xx error from server, note that sent and dropped are 0
r.droppedHttp.Add(numMeasurements)
}
r.invalidMetrics.Add(dropped)
r.sentMetrics.Add(sent)
}
}
}
func (r *Registry) publish() {
if len(r.config.Uri) == 0 {
return
}
measurements := r.Measurements()
r.config.Log.Debugf("Got %d measurements", len(measurements))
if !r.config.IsEnabled() {
return
}
wg := new(sync.WaitGroup)
for i := 0; i < len(measurements); i += r.config.BatchSize {
end := i + r.config.BatchSize
if end > len(measurements) {
end = len(measurements)
}
err := r.publishSync.Acquire(context.Background(), 1)
if err != nil {
r.config.Log.Errorf("Unable to acquire semaphore: %v.", err)
return
}
wg.Add(1)
go func(m []Measurement) {
r.sendBatch(m)
r.publishSync.Release(1)
wg.Done()
}(measurements[i:end])
}
wg.Wait()
}
func (r *Registry) buildStringTable(payload *[]interface{}, measurements []Measurement) map[string]int {
strTable := make(map[string]int)
commonTags := r.config.CommonTags
for k, v := range commonTags {
strTable[k] = 0
strTable[v] = 0
}
strTable["name"] = 0
for _, measure := range measurements {
strTable[measure.id.name] = 0
for k, v := range measure.id.tags {
strTable[k] = 0
strTable[v] = 0
}
}
sortedStrings := make([]string, 0, len(strTable))
for s := range strTable {
sortedStrings = append(sortedStrings, s)
}
sort.Strings(sortedStrings)
for i, s := range sortedStrings {
strTable[s] = i
}
*payload = append(*payload, len(strTable))
// can't append the strings in one call since we can't convert []string to []interface{}
for _, s := range sortedStrings {
*payload = append(*payload, s)
}
return strTable
}
const (
addOp = 0
maxOp = 10
)
func opFromTags(tags map[string]string) int {
switch tags["statistic"] {
case "count", "totalAmount", "totalTime", "totalOfSquares", "percentile":
return addOp
default:
return maxOp
}
}
func (r *Registry) appendMeasurement(payload *[]interface{}, strings map[string]int, m Measurement) {
op := opFromTags(m.id.tags)
commonTags := r.config.CommonTags
*payload = append(*payload, len(m.id.tags)+1+len(commonTags))
for k, v := range commonTags {
*payload = append(*payload, strings[k])
*payload = append(*payload, strings[v])
}
for k, v := range m.id.tags {
*payload = append(*payload, strings[k])
*payload = append(*payload, strings[v])
}
*payload = append(*payload, strings["name"])
*payload = append(*payload, strings[m.id.name])
*payload = append(*payload, op)
*payload = append(*payload, m.value)
}
func (r *Registry) measurementsToJson(measurements []Measurement) ([]byte, error) {
var payload []interface{}
stringTable := r.buildStringTable(&payload, measurements)
for _, m := range measurements {
r.appendMeasurement(&payload, stringTable, m)
}
return json.Marshal(payload)
}
// MeterFactoryFun is a type to allow dependency injection of the function used to generate meters.
type MeterFactoryFun func() Meter
// NewMeter registers a new meter internally, and then returns it to the caller.
// The meterFactory is used to generate this meter. If the id.MapKey() is
// already present in the internal collection, that is returned instead of
// creating a new one.
func (r *Registry) NewMeter(id *Id, meterFactory MeterFactoryFun) Meter {
r.mutex.Lock()
defer r.mutex.Unlock()
meter, exists := r.meters[id.MapKey()]
if !exists {
meter = meterFactory()
r.meters[id.MapKey()] = meter
}
return meter
}
// NewId calls spectator.NewId().
func (r *Registry) NewId(name string, tags map[string]string) *Id {
return NewId(name, tags)
}
// CounterWithId returns a new *Counter, using the provided meter identifier.
func (r *Registry) CounterWithId(id *Id) *Counter {
m := r.NewMeter(id, func() Meter {
return NewCounter(id)
})
c, ok := m.(*Counter)
if ok {
return c
}
r.config.Log.Errorf("Unable to register a counter with id=%v - a meter %v exists", id, c)
// should throw in strict mode
return NewCounter(id)
}
// Counter calls NewId() with the name and tags, and then calls r.CounterWithId()
// using that *Id.
func (r *Registry) Counter(name string, tags map[string]string) *Counter {
return r.CounterWithId(NewId(name, tags))
}
// TimerWithId returns a new *Timer, using the provided meter identifier.
func (r *Registry) TimerWithId(id *Id) *Timer {
m := r.NewMeter(id, func() Meter {
return NewTimer(id)
})
t, ok := m.(*Timer)
if ok {
return t
}
r.config.Log.Errorf("Unable to register a timer with %v - a meter %v exists", id, t)
// throw in strict mode
return NewTimer(id)
}
// Timer calls NewId() with the name and tags, and then calls r.TimerWithId()
// using that *Id.
func (r *Registry) Timer(name string, tags map[string]string) *Timer {
return r.TimerWithId(NewId(name, tags))
}
// GaugeWithId returns a new *Gauge, using the provided meter identifier.
func (r *Registry) GaugeWithId(id *Id) *Gauge {
m := r.NewMeter(id, func() Meter {
return NewGauge(id)
})
g, ok := m.(*Gauge)
if ok {
return g
}
r.config.Log.Errorf("Unable to register a gauge with id=%v - a meter %v exists", id, g)
// throw in strict mode
return NewGauge(id)
}
// Gauge calls NewId() with the name and tags, and then calls r.GaugeWithId()
// using that *Id.
func (r *Registry) Gauge(name string, tags map[string]string) *Gauge {
return r.GaugeWithId(NewId(name, tags))
}
// DistributionSummaryWithId returns a new *DistributionSummary, using the
// provided meter identifier.
func (r *Registry) DistributionSummaryWithId(id *Id) *DistributionSummary {
m := r.NewMeter(id, func() Meter {
return NewDistributionSummary(id)
})
d, ok := m.(*DistributionSummary)
if ok {
return d
}
r.config.Log.Errorf("Unable to register a distribution summary with id=%v - a meter %v exists", id, d)
// throw in strict mode
return NewDistributionSummary(id)
}
// DistributionSummary calls NewId() using the name and tags, and then calls
// r.DistributionSummaryWithId() using that *Id.
func (r *Registry) DistributionSummary(name string, tags map[string]string) *DistributionSummary {
return r.DistributionSummaryWithId(NewId(name, tags))
}
